Understanding Hidden Camera Detection Technologies
Hidden camera detection technologies have evolved significantly, offering a range of devices designed to uncover covert surveillance equipment. At their core, these technologies rely on different sensing and imaging capabilities to identify potential hidden cameras. One common approach is the use of infrared or thermal imaging, which can detect heat signatures unique to electronic devices like cameras. This method is particularly effective in low-light conditions and can reveal hidden cameras that might evade visible light detection.
Comparing Hidden Camera Detection Devices (HCDDs) reveals a diverse set of capabilities. Some devices employ motion sensors to trigger alerts when unusual movements are detected, potentially indicating the presence of a hidden camera. Others utilize advanced algorithms for image analysis, capable of recognizing patterns and signatures associated with camera lenses or circuit boards. While each HCDD has its strengths, choosing the right one depends on factors like sensitivity, coverage area, and environmental conditions, making a thorough comparison crucial before deployment.

Legal Considerations for Camera Concealment
When planning to install hidden security cameras, understanding legal considerations is paramount. Different jurisdictions have varying laws regarding surveillance and privacy rights, so it’s crucial to research local regulations before proceeding. One key aspect to consider is the Hidden Camera Detection Devices Comparison. Some regions require explicit consent from individuals being monitored, while others permit hidden cameras for security purposes with certain restrictions.
Violating privacy laws can lead to legal repercussions, including fines and lawsuits. It’s essential to disclose the presence of surveillance equipment when necessary and ensure compliance with data protection acts. Consulting a legal expert specialized in privacy law is advisable to navigate these complexities and avoid potential pitfalls associated with improper camera concealment practices.
